Solaris x86 + Tecra M2 : Sound Support

It took me two days to realize that my sound wasn't working on the Solaris Community Express installation on my Toshiba Tecra M2. It took me a couple of hours of digging, both on the system, and on Google, to find links to a couple of articles that between them had the information I needed to get sound working. It's actually very simple.

The drivers I found at http://www.tools.de/solaris/audio/beta/ worked perfectly for me.

I downloaded and installed the TOOLSi810 package from the tools.de site, and then did the following:

update_drv -d -i '"pci8086,24c5"' audio810
update_drv -a -i '"pci8086,24c5"' audioi810

The first line removes the Sun driver that doesn't work with my hardware, and the second line adds the TOOLS driver_alias.
Note that the PCI addresses are wrapped in single-quotes outside of double-quotes.
Now, reboot and you'll be all set. Hopefully.
